Jim and Joy Cordray of White River Campground in Montague Michigan won the Seasonal Operators of the Year award at the 2008 Stars of the Industry Awards Dinner. The awards ceremony is part of the Driving Tourism Conference that is the annual statewide gathering for the tourism industry. Jim and Joy were received the honor at the Amway Grand Plaza Hotel on April 15, 2008.
As owners of the Campground, Jim and Joy Cordray have been active in the tourism industry since 1974. Their seasonal campground offers a wide range of amenities and accommodates all campers from tents to the big rigs. In addition Jim and Joy own Jim and Joy Cordray, White River Campground, Montague, Michigan providing scenic tours down the White River for their guests.
Besides providing outstanding facilities for their campers and canoeists, Jim and Joy do an incredible job of staying informed of issues that affect tourism in Michigan and are often leading others in their grass roots efforts. Jim and Joy have proven to be persuasive influencing issues within and on behalf of the tourism industry over the past 34 years. The Cordray’s were founding board members of the Association of RV Parks and Campgrounds of Michigan. In the last year they have continued their legacy of involvement as Joy graciously serves on the ARVC Michigan Board of Directors, and Jim has been working hard to influence legislative issues that affect Michigan waterways.
Jim and Joy Cordray are a fine example of a tourism business that has helped lay the foundation for the Michigan camping industry as a national leader in providing high quality campground and outdoor recreation experiences to the tourism consumer. However they didn’t stop there; they have continued to be involved in helping to direct the future of the industry through mentoring of new campground operators, active involvement in the industry, and in their awareness of issues that may affect the tourism industry, often before they rise to the political forefront.
